Jeff Ellis's Homepage


My homepage was getting way out of date (like 5+ years), so I've taken most of the content offline for now. The links below are still valid. Other content will be added when I get around to updating it. Come back and visit to see if I've made any progress. Also feel free to e-mail me at with any comments or suggestions.
